"该资源是一个关于‘小区物业信息管理系统’的PPT演示,由DiscoverySoft工作室制作,包含全套源码,适用于JSP编程初学者学习和提升。系统基于Web模式,采用JSP+JavaBean+JavaServlet技术实现,后端数据库为MS-Access,旨在提供一个供技术交流和学习参考的平台,禁止用于商业目的。"
小区物业信息管理系统是一个综合性的应用项目,旨在优化和自动化物业管理中的各项任务。系统主要分为以下几个核心功能模块:
1. **楼盘信息管理**:此模块用于记录和管理小区内的楼房信息,包括楼号、层数、户型等,方便物业进行统一规划和管理。
2. **住户信息管理**:物业管理系统能够存储和更新住户的基本信息,如住户姓名、联系方式、居住单元等,便于物业与住户之间的沟通和服务。
3. **物业收费管理**:系统支持物业费用的计算、收取和记录,包括物业费、水电费、停车费等,确保财务管理的准确性和效率。
4. **用户报修管理**:住户可以通过系统提交报修申请,物业可以跟踪处理进度,提高维修服务的响应速度和质量。
5. **用户投诉管理**:住户可以在线提交投诉,物业可及时了解并处理问题,提升服务质量。
6. **小区公告管理**:物业管理方可以发布小区通知和公告,确保信息的快速传播和住户的知情权。
7. **系统帮助**:提供操作指南和常见问题解答,帮助用户更好地理解和使用系统。
在技术实现上,该系统采用了三层架构设计,包括:
- **用户界面层**:主要由JSP和HTML文件组成,负责与用户交互,展示信息和接收用户输入。
- **业务处理层**:使用JavaBean和JavaServlet处理业务逻辑,执行如数据验证、计算、事务处理等操作。
- **数据存储层**:通过MS-Access数据库存储所有数据,确保数据的安全性和一致性。
这样的设计模式使得系统具有良好的模块化和可扩展性,同时面向对象的设计原则增加了代码的复用性和维护性。此外,系统还注重用户体验,力求界面友好和操作简便。
这个小区物业信息管理系统是一个全面覆盖物业管理需求的工具,不仅有助于提高物业工作效率,也能提升住户满意度。对于学习JSP和Web应用开发的人员来说,它是一个有价值的实践案例和学习材料。